              you know when you go for a walk and sometimes a few Swans thoughts pop in.........

              I was trying to think over the last two decades is Collingwood the only team to win a GF that didnt have an out and out Key forward that kicked 50 or 60 plus goals in the same season winning the GF

              Melbourne had Frisch score about 60 goals in 2021 GF year who is a 188cm ish medium tall

              Does that mean the pressure is really back on Heeney to be that 50 plus goal scorer and less pressure on our 3 young talls to be the heroes in 2024?

              Are the medium talls making a come back and creating more havoc and space for the traditional Key Forwards?

                  We didn’t have one in 2012. Lewis Jetta was our top goal kicker that season with 46. That’s an impressive tally but he certainly didn’t get them as a power forward.
